FORM 45‑110F3
FUNDING PORTAL INFORMATION

 

 

GENERAL INSTRUCTION:

 

If the funding portal is relying on the start-up crowdfunding registration exemption (section 3 of the Instrument), the funding portal must complete and deliver this form with any attachments and all corresponding Forms 45‑110F4 Portal Individual Information to the securities regulatory authority or regulator if the funding portal facilitates or intends to facilitate a crowdfunding distribution.

CRIMINAL DISCLOSURE

 

11.  Has the funding portal ever been found guilty, pleaded no contest to, or been granted an absolute or conditional discharge from

 

(a)               a summary conviction or indictable offence under the Criminal Code,

(b)               a quasi-criminal offence in any jurisdiction of Canada or a foreign jurisdiction,

(c)               a misdemeanor or felony under the criminal legislation of the United States of America, or any state or territory therein, or

(d)               an offence under the criminal legislation of any other foreign jurisdiction?

 

Yes       No

 

If yes, provide all relevant details in an attachment signed and dated by the authorized individual certifying this form that includes the circumstances, relevant dates, names of the parties involved and the final disposition, if a final disposition has been made.

 

Instruction: A quasi-criminal offence includes an offence under the Income Tax Act (Canada), the Immigration and Refugee Protection Act (Canada) or the tax, immigration, drugs, firearms, money laundering or securities legislation of any province or territory of Canada or foreign jurisdiction.

PROCESS AND PROCEDURE FOR HANDLING OF FUNDS

 

15.  Provide all relevant details in an attachment that is signed and dated by the authorized individual certifying this form of the relevant documents on the process and procedure for handling all funds in relation to the crowdfunding distribution in a designated trust account at a Canadian financial institution, including the following:

 

(a)               the name of the Canadian financial institution the funding portal will use with the designated trust account number;

(b)               the names of the signatories on this account and their role with the funding portal;

(c)               details of how the funds held in this account will be separate and apart from the funding portal’s own property;

(d)               a copy of the trust agreement, or details surrounding the establishment of this account. If the funding portal does not have a trust agreement or an account, please explain;

(e)               details regarding how funds will flow

                                      (i)               from purchasers to the funding portal’s account,

 

                                   (ii)               from the funding portal’s account to the issuer in the event that the crowdfunding distribution closes, and

 

                                 (iii)               from the funding portal’s account back to the purchasers in the event that the crowdfunding distribution does not close or the purchaser has exercised their right of withdrawal.

CERTIFICATION

 

By signing this form, the funding portal

 

         undertakes to comply with all of the applicable conditions set out in National Instrument 45-110 Start-up Crowdfunding Registration and Prospectus Exemptions,

 

         certifies that its platform is complete, ready for viewing in a test environment and designed to comply with National Instrument 45-110 Start-up Crowdfunding Registration and Prospectus Exemptions,

 

         certifies that it has, or reasonably expects to have, sufficient financial resources to continue its operations for at least the next 6 months, and

 

         acknowledges that the securities regulatory authority or regulator of a jurisdiction in which this form is submitted may access the books and records relating to the carrying on of its activities and may conduct a compliance review.
